Man ‘acting suspiciously’ on Glasgow-bound train leaves suitcase containing £6,000 worth of cannabis on board

An investigation has been launched after a man ‘acting suspiciously’ left a suitcase containing £6,000 worth of cannabis on a train.

On Tuesday, staff on board a Glasgow-bound train contacted the British Transport Police (BTP) after noticing the man acting in a suspicious manner.

The man alighted the train at Motherwell, leaving behind a suitcase which contained cannabis worth thousands of pounds.

The BTP said that they are now investigating the incident in a bid to trace the man.
